Heather Fleming is an accomplished educator, translator, and expert in German language and literature. With fluency in academic and conversational German, as well as a strong background in cultural politics and language in East Germany, she is highly regarded in her field. Heather has studied extensively, earning a Master's in German Literature from the University of Pennsylvania and a Doctoral Research degree in Germanistik from Humboldt-Universität zu Berlin. Additionally, she has coursework in literature, sociology, music, and is fluent in Dutch, French, and several ancient Germanic languages. Her educational experience includes teaching at various levels, from German School of San Francisco to the University of California, Irvine. Heather specializes in German instruction, secondary and primary education, and higher education. Her expertise includes German to English translation in art, music, literature, culture, and more, with an emphasis on academic writing. Heather is a 200-Hour RYT certified expert in Iyengar Yoga and holds several diplomas in German, French, English, and music. She has also worked as a program coordinator, teacher, tutor, and translator.
